THE HON'BLE SRI JUSTICE P. NAVEEN RAO WRIT PETITION No.23984 OF 2018 ORDER:
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ned Standing Counsel for Telangana State Road Transport Corporation (TSRTC) appearing for the respondents.
2.
Petitioner was appointed as Driver in TSRTC. He claims that he cannot undertake the job of driving and therefore he should be given alternative employment instead of continuing him as Driver. 3.
Petitioner placed reliance on medical record of 2015. The material on record would disclose that so far no representation was made by petitioner requesting to subject him for medical examination about his fitness.
4.
On the contrary, learned Standing Counsel for the TSRTC submits that in fact in January, 2016 and on 04.04.2017, medical examination was conducted and petitioner was declared as 'Fit for Driver in A1 category'.
5.
The Court is not expressing any opinion on the earlier medical reports. If petitioner contends that he is not medically fit to discharge the duty of Driver, it is always open to him to make a representation with supporting material to show that he is unwell and cannot discharge the duties of a Driver. If such a representation is made, it is open to the competent authority to consider the said representation and take appropriate decision as warranted in law.
6.
The Writ Petition is accordingly disposed of. There shall be no order as to costs. Pending Miscellaneous Petitions, if any, shall stand closed.
